Output 491ccb66fa9caba6f934bd5b60366af44b319e9f2bc02831a2b61ed2eeccd0af:27

value
2332858631
script pubkey
OP_0 OP_PUSHBYTES_20 ec383c496dbbbefb76b6060588baf8ac56635c89
address
ltc1qasurcjtdhwl0ka4kqczc3whc43txxhyfzplhgc
transaction
491ccb66fa9caba6f934bd5b60366af44b319e9f2bc02831a2b61ed2eeccd0af
spent
true